Holland Codes (RIASEC)

Holland Codes, also known as RIASEC, are a personality typology used to help individuals identify careers that match their interests and strengths. Developed by psychologist John Holland, the model categorizes people and work environments into six types: Realistic, Investigative, Artistic, Social, Enterprising, and Conventional. By understanding their dominant types, individuals can find careers that feel more engaging and satisfying. The RIASEC system is widely used in career counseling and vocational guidance to facilitate informed decision-making and improve job satisfaction by aligning personal preferences with suitable work environments.
